Special moment for Indian sports: PM Modi praises Avani Lekhara who clinched gold in Paralympics

| @indiablooms | Aug 30, 2021, at 05:04 pm

New Delhi/IBNS: Praising shooter Avani Lekha, who clinched the gold medal in Paralympics 2021 Monday, Prime Minister Narendra Modi said it was a special moment for Indian sports.

Modi tweeted, "Phenomenal performance @AvaniLekhara! Congratulations on winning a hard-earned and well-deserved Gold, made possible due to your industrious nature and passion towards shooting. This is truly a special moment for Indian sports. Best wishes for your future endeavours."

India got their new icon on Monday when shooter Avani Lekhara clinched the gold medal in the  women's 10m Air Rifle Standing (SH1) event at the Tokyo Paralympics on Monday.

Avani won the gold medal by scoring the Paralympics record of 249.6.
